It was not the role of those judges \u2013 chief justice Anne Ferguson, court of appeal president justice Chris Maxwell and justice Mark Weinberg \u2013 to decide Pell\u2019s guilt. Rather, the question they needed to consider was whether the 12 jurors who found Pell guilty in December must have held a reasonable doubt as to his guilt based on the evidence before them; not that they could have, or should have. This was vital to Pell\u2019s appeal on the key ground that the jury made an unreasonable decision.
